My room was on the 4th flr., non-smoking. It had 2 queen beds, tv w/remote, air conditioning, ceiling fan w/2 speeds, complimentry shampoo which I didnt expect and a real small fridge that was adequate. In the fridge was 1/2gal. guava juice, 6pack coke, 6pack beer and some exotic fruit which I put all in and the fridge as able to handle all that.
They have continental breakfast and had sliced local papaya, pineapple chunks(canned), bread for toast and english muffins with condiments, plus juices and coffee. Most places dont even have that.
This is right in the middle of all the shops and restuarants. The farmers market is right next door. Only 5min. walk are 4 or 5 restaurants and across the street is the Kona Inn restaurant which I ate there and it was great. Price was $78 per night plus taxes. I parked my rental car in the lot on one side of the hotel and was close to the elevator. They had washers, dryers and laundry soap you could use. you had to deposit quarters, like anywhere else.
Yea, I saw a small lizard on a chair. But you know, this is Hawaii and its tropical and the place isnt that urban like a large city. you have to expect those things.
Granted somethings may have been outdated, but the room was clean and when the a/c was on and the fan going, it was great just to lay down and relax a minute.
If you want real fancy stuff and updated flat screen tv, then go somewhere else and pay more. If youre going to leave the room about 9am and not be back until 4 or 5pm, then this is the place.
